A motorcycle destroyed in a suspicious fire was stolen from a property in Plymouth.

The blaze happened at Woollcombe Avenue, Plympton, at about 05:30 BST.

Devon and Somerset Fire and Rescue Service said the motorcycle was "totally destroyed" in the blaze, which had spread to a tree.

Devon and Cornwall Police said the cause of the fire was being "treated as suspicious" and inquiries were ongoing.
